WebBotanical Name: Herniaria glabra. Other Common Names: Smooth rupturewort, glabrous rupturewort, herniary, green carpet, brudurt (Danish), herniaire (French), Bruchkraut (German), herniaria (Spanish). Habitat: … WebHerniaria glabra green carpet rupturewort grows as a low growing perennial in USDA Zones 6 - 10. This mat forming carpet only reaches approximately 3 inches in height making it a perfect lawn alternative or ground cover plant.

WebHerniaria glabra Rupturewort USDA Zone: 5-9 Plant number: 1.260.020 Known to be nearly indestructible, this is an excellent choice for growing between flagstones or growing as a lawn substitute. The tiny leaves create a dense evergreen carpet, becoming bronze in winter. Insignificant green flowers. Easily divided in spring. WebHerniaria glabra, or Green Carpet, is an evergreen, carpet-forming perennial with tiny green leaves that turn slightly bronze in winter. It has inconspicuous white star flowers in summer. Also known as Rupturewort, Herniaria glabra is excellent between stepping stones or used as a ground cover.
